Rumah > hujung hadapan web > tutorial js > Melaksanakan kod lompat automatik kira detik halaman web berdasarkan kemahiran JavaScript_javascript

Melaksanakan kod lompat automatik kira detik halaman web berdasarkan kemahiran JavaScript_javascript

WBOY
Lepaskan: 2016-05-16 15:23:11
asal
1712 orang telah melayarinya

Gunakan JS untuk merealisasikan fungsi lompat automatik pada halaman web. Kira detik akan melompat ke halaman web yang ditentukan Masa undur boleh ditetapkan sendiri Apabila masa tamat, ia akan melompat ke URL yang ditentukan secara automatik. Untuk JS, nampaknya agak mudah untuk melaksanakan ini Anda juga boleh menggunakan 301 pada IIS untuk mencapai lompatan, dan tag mete juga boleh mencapai lompatan automatik, mengikut keperluan anda sendiri.

<title>JS倒计时网页自动跳转代码</title>  
<script language="JavaScript" type="text/javascript">
  function delayURL(url) {
    var delay = document.getElementById("time").innerHTML;
    if(delay > 0) {
      delay--;
      document.getElementById("time").innerHTML = delay;
    } else {
      window.top.location.href = url;
    }
    t = setTimeout("delayURL('" + url + "')", 1000);
  }
function stop1(){  
t && clearTimeout(t);
}
</script>
<span id="time" style="background: #00BFFF">1000</span>秒钟后自动跳转,如果不跳转,请点击下面的链接<a href="http://www.baidu.com">我的百度</a>
<input type="button" value="停止跳转" onclick="stop1();">
<script type="text/javascript">
delayURL("http://www.baidu.com");
</script>
Salin selepas log masuk

Kandungan di atas ialah kod lompat undur halaman automatik berasaskan JavaScript yang dikongsi oleh editor.

s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an